How can you tell if a rosy maple moth is male or female?

In the case of the rosy maple moth, males have narrower and less rounded wings. Additionally, while females have simple antennae, males have bipectinate (comb-like on both sides) antennae to sense females’ pheromones during mating. The moths become sexually mature at 2 to 9 months of age.

Are rosy maple moth in Canada?

The rosy maple moth lives across the eastern United States and adjacent regions of Canada. Their northernmost range includes the southern regions of Canada, including Ontario, Quebec, New Brunswick, Nova Scotia, and Prince Edward Island.

Can you touch a rosy maple moth?

Turns out the caterpillar of this tiny moth is one of the so-called stinging caterpillars. It has urticating spines that contain a toxin and can irritate human skin if they come in contact with you.

Can moths drink water?

With few exceptions, adult butterflies and moths eat only various liquids to maintain their water balance and energy stores. Most adults sip flower nectar, but other imbibe fluids from sap flowers on trees, rotting fruits, bird droppings, or animal dung.

Can moths poop?

Interestingly, when there enough caterpillars eating in the same place, their defecation is audible. That is, you can hear the poop! When gypsy moths (Lymantria dispar) infest a forest, the defecation of the caterpillars sounds like rain.
